<i>Jones and Davis are fighting.</i><br/><i>There's a skeleton in the well.</i><br/><i>There's more to being Welsh than having the accent isn't there?<br/><br/></i>Written for a single performer Tara Robinson and Steffan Donnelly's <i>My Body Welsh</i> is a lyrical thriller which guides the audience through Llanfair-pwllgwyngyll-gogery-chwyrn-drobwll-llan-tysilio-gogo-goch and into a world of slippery small-town myth-making. <br/><br/><i>My Body Welsh</i> is a vibrant part-bilingual piece of contemporary theatre that investigates the role storytelling plays in constructing national identity. <br/><br/><i>My Body Welsh</i> was published to coincide with Invertigo Theatre's tour of the play in January 2017.
